1) Open Registry Editor.
2) Open the submenus:
[HKEY_LOCAL_MACHINE]-->[SOFTWARE]-->[Microsoft]-->[Windows]-->[CurrentVersion]-->[Explorer].
3) Find string value [AlwaysUnloadDLL] and double click it. Then modify the default value 1 to 0. If the string value does not exist, right click [Explorer] and select New, then select String Value. You will see a new item on the right window, then name it as [AlwaysUnloadDLL] and set the value as 0.
0 means useless dll files are disabled.
Then restart your computer. After you do this will make the Windows XP startup faster by several seconds and run quicker. But there are thousands of registry keys in the windows XP.
